Anyway, for those local PPers or those who have plans of visiting the Philippines in the near future, here are a couple of possible vacation spots for you.

The first is Caramoan Island in Camarines Sur. You want to hear a good reason why you need to go there - one word - Survivor!.The show Survivor taped back to back seasons there. Enough said. If Survivor thinks the place is good enough to shoot not one but two seasons then the place is surely worth a visit. Have you ever thought of visiting a place because your favorite show featured it? The second one is an off-center choice. Not as popular as other obvious vacation spots but this one is really nice. Read some good reviews about Lawiswis Kawayan Resort. It is located in Calumpit, Bulacan. I saw an article in one of the daily broadsheets and visited the resort's website. I think for the prices that they posted for the services and amenities that they offer, the price is well worth it. I'm booking my trip to the place by the 3rd week of April.
